Endpoint Monitoring

Security personnel must create awareness of all devices connected in a system and put protections in order to spot and neutralize cyberthreats that aim to attack them in order to successfully manage endpoint threats.

Endpoint monitoring is the process of gathering, aggregating, and analyzing endpoint behaviors throughout the context of an organization to spot indications of fraudulent attacks. Usually, to do this, a benchmark of what defines regular behavior is established, and any departures from it are noted.

Endpoint monitoring is made easier by EDR solutions, which record significant endpoint occurrences like registration and document modifications and use real-time behavioral surveillance to identify suspect activities.

Endpoint security monitoring’s difficulties

Early endpoint threat identification is essential, but organizations won’t be able to reach the safety benefits these solutions can provide without experienced security specialists to maintain and watch over EDR and other endpoint surveillance solutions around-the-clock.

The more endpoints and apps that are tracked by endpoint monitoring systems, the more information is ingested, and the more safety notifications are generated as a result. Due to an increasing intricacy brought on by this, internal teams may find it challenging to handle them because they frequently lack the specialized security expertise needed to understand them.

Additionally, effective threat information is needed to get the most out of endpoint monitoring solutions like EDR. Most EDR systems do not come with this, or the customized rulesets needed to aggressively detect the most recent risks. Building surveillance systems that are specifically customized to an organization’s unique risk tolerance requires specialized degree of skill.

Warning weariness is unavoidable in the absence of sufficient assets, and sophisticated systems can be soon rendered outdated. An increasing vulnerability to cyber-attacks is a natural result of these difficulties. Organizations are progressively seeking external assistance to develop endpoint detection and mitigation abilities to close the distance.

Important Factors to Consider for Endpoint Monitoring and Management

Visibility of every endpoint

Whether it’s a hardware device or a digital one, gather as much information as you can about each terminal to gain as much transparency as you can into them. Understand the underlying platform that is being used, the apps or functions that are being hosted, the various endpoints to which it can link, and so on.

Knowing what each terminal is used for, who has connection to it, if its programming is current, and any other operational or protection details that can assist you manage the endpoint should be your aim.



Endpoint Software Management

In order to identify illegitimate programs or services, find out what software is installed on endpoints. In order to determine whether these programs and services are outdated and potentially vulnerable to security flaws, you need also keep track of their software updates.

Until they become secure, unsecure endpoints should be removed from the system or at the very least stopped from connecting with other network nodes.

Adopting a “zero trust” strategy will yield the greatest results because it prevents new devices from connecting until their security has been verified. This method is safer than assuming terminals are trustworthy by definition and afterwards identifying and separating those that aren’t.

Property Management for IT

Your staff may gather information on the condition of each IT property with the use of terminal assessment and management technologies, which can be helpful for property administration. You can, for instance, monitor the physical device ages and the licensing condition of programs operating on terminals. This knowledge will assist you in making alternative plans.

This does not imply that your IT resource control plan should be only based on endpoint tracking, but it may be helpful.

Threat detection

Attacks can be identified using information gathered from terminals and their activity. Abnormal network communication behaviors from a destination that has previously acted strangely, for instance, may indicate possible exploitation.

In the case of a security problem, keeping track of endpoints and related network traffic will also help you figure out how many endpoints were impacted. Endpoint information can also be used to determine how many devices might be susceptible to specific assaults depending on the technology applications they are currently using.

Additionally, if a live assault is happening, you can use knowledge of endpoint settings to confine the assault to a specific area of your system by disabling connection to the compromised terminals.

Alerts and Reports

When you set up automated notifications to inform your staff of possible endpoint issues, the different sorts of actions mentioned above function best.

In order to observe network behaviors over period and use that information to back up capacity management, you can also create recurring summaries about the state of the system or specific terminals. If you want to know, for instance, how many smart phones are connected to the network at various times of the day or if you need to update your network’s hardware to handle continual growth in bandwidth demand, report information may be helpful.

What is endpoint security?

Endpoint security is the term used to describe the defense of internet-connected gadgets against online dangers. PCs, desktops, servers, cellphones, iPads, and Internet of Things devices are examples of endpoints.

What is endpoint security that is unified?

When protection measures are combined, they function more effectively. An endpoint protection technology that integrates EDR, EPP, antivirus/antimalware, and other risk defenses into a unified, central management panel is known as a unified endpoint security platform. To put it another way, it's a cutting-edge endpoint security product that enables IT specialists to control many endpoints via a single user interaction.

This method of monitoring endpoints gives IT professionals a bird's-eye perspective of their endpoint network and enables them to make improved security choices. The destinations and network mapping can be better understood to help identify security flaws more rapidly and remediate them.
